## SDK Parity Provenance

KestrelKit ships two client SDKs (Dart and Kotlin) that must expose identical surface area per release. Parity is enforced by the `apidiff` stage: both SDKs are generated from the same interface manifest, and any drift fails the pipeline. Release manager: do not tag a release unless both SDK artifacts reference the same manifest digest. Current parity status for the upcoming 2.8 cut is green. The attesting build is identified by the token below.

trace token, fafog-kageg: htk4_98e6

## Releases

Paritylark is our hotel rate-parity checker: it crawls configured booking channels, normalizes currencies and cancellation terms, and flags listings where a property's direct rate diverges from channel rates beyond a set threshold. Releases are cut from the main branch every other Thursday, tagged, and built in the Dunmoral CI pool. Each release artifact is signed so downstream consumers can verify provenance before deploying to the comparison fleet. New team members verifying a build should check signatures against the key below.

deploy key for kajof-fajop: bky6_gDHw9Q

## Formula Sandbox — Support Notes

User formulas in Calqueron run inside the Wrenhold sandbox: no network, no file access, 200 ms CPU cap. Timeouts return error F-408; escalate only if the same formula passes in the sandbox replay tool. Never paste customer formulas into production consoles. Replay bundles you forward to engineering must be signed or they'll be discarded. Sign them with the key below.

deploy key for kajof-yawif: bky9_fvxrpdHPq